Florida’s new coaching staff is making a desperate push to land elite wide receiver Tra’Von Hall, a shifty, versatile talent from Oklahoma who’s already racked up over 800 yards and 11 TDs — nearly 60% of his yards coming on the ground. With comparisons to Percy Harvin and a clear fit in new OC Buster Faulkner’s offense, Hall sees himself thriving in Florida’s dynamic scheme. His official visit this weekend could be the turning point — with Ole Miss and Oklahoma still in the mix — as the Gators aim to elevate their already strong 2027 class with a game-changing playmaker.
